CAPTCHA field causing Insert Record to not occur

I'm able to create a simple form...and use an Insert Record server behavior to add a record to my database. However when I include a CAPTCHA field using the FB and use Server Validation that is automatically setup for me by FB, the Insert Record no longer works.

It may be my CAPTCHA code. If I purposely type in the CAPTCHA security code that doesn't match the image...I don’t get any error messages stating it wrong…Nor is the Failed Redirect URL invoked (as defined in the Server Validation).

If I type in the security code correctly.....my record Insert doesn’t occur as expected.

I’m a little suspicious of how the WA Server Validation code looks as there doesn’t appear to be anything in it about verifying the Security Code field. I've tried setting up a Server Validation specifically for the Security Code using "Like Entry" with Server variable from WA Server Validation Entries (Security Coder) with the Security Code field in my form...but not been very successful in getting Server Validation to work for the Security Code field or the the Insert Record server behavior.

Any suggestions.
